The Paradigm Shift from Passive Recording to Intelligent Real-time Processing
The global video surveillance industry is experiencing a profound technological transformation. Standard closed-circuit systems (CCTV) are being phased out in favor of intelligent surveillance pipelines that integrate Edge Computing, Deep Learning Models (such as DeepSeek and convolutional neural networks), and massive multi-tenant cloud architectures.
Modern surveillance relies on processing hundreds of high-definition video streams simultaneously. Standard CPU architectures struggle with the parallel compute demands of real-time object detection, license plate recognition (LPR), and behavioral pattern analysis. Enterprise-grade AI GPU servers are now mandatory to avoid ingestion bottlenecks.
Hybrid surveillance topologies deploy localized 1U and 2U servers with short-depth rack frames to perform initial AI inference on-premise, while streaming optimized telemetry to large-scale data center GPU clusters. This methodology significantly minimizes external bandwidth utilization and reduces response latency to milliseconds.
Critical infrastructure, federal sites, and large-scale enterprises mandate hardware-level security, virtualization setups (Hyperconverged Infrastructure), and redundant fail-safe mechanisms to safeguard data integrity and adhere to strict regulatory compliance directives such as GDPR and NDAA.

Configured Hardware Architectures for Diverse Industrial Contexts
Deploying AI Inference servers (such as the G5200 V5) at edge intersections. These systems continuously parse high-framerate IP video feeds, executing low-latency calculations to adjust traffic lights dynamically, identify collisions, and detect illegal parking events.
Utilizing high-performance GPU networks integrated with hyperconverged nodes to monitor customer paths, demographic trends, heatmaps, and automatically flag suspicious behaviors. This system optimizes operational management and deters theft.
Automated safety monitoring in hazardous environments. Video systems running on high-availability, multi-socket rack servers continuously check if workers are wearing proper personal protective equipment (PPE) like helmets and harnesses, and immediately flag unauthorized zone intrusions.
Remaining Ahead of the Technology Curve in Video Analytics
Modern surveillance is moving away from static analysis. The integration of advanced model parameters directly onto localized GPU architectures allows for conversational visual search queries (e.g., "Find a red jacket carrying a black briefcase").
As video resolutions shift to 4K and 8K, hardware throughput is the primary constraint. Transitioning server specifications to support high-bandwidth DDR5 memories and PCIe Gen5 expansion slots increases video decoding efficiency by up to 2.5 times.
Instead of operating separate machines for VMS (Video Management Software), storage databases, and AI algorithms, unified system architectures running virtualization packages save energy, spatial footprint, and deployment costs.
High density processing generates substantial heat. Modern computing units are designed to support fluid liquid cooling systems and high-efficiency power supplies (such as HVDC modules) to lower overall power usage effectiveness (PUE).
